Russia's New Electronic Warfare Anti-Drone Systems Fortify the Security Line for Urban Activities

Russia is stepping up the development and improvement of a variety of anti-drone equipment to cope with the increasingly severe threat of drones.
“Amulet” System
  • Development Background: Developed by Russia's unmanned systems and technology center at the request of soldiers in the special military operation zone.
  • Functional Features: It can interfere with the video communication signals of enemy drones and is an improved version of the portable “Mirror” device, specifically designed for special forces soldiers. The “Mirror” is both an electronic warfare system and a radio reconnaissance system, capable of detecting and automatically suppressing enemy video signals.
“Cover” Electronic Warfare Tools
  • Research and Development Unit: “Kilowatt” Scientific and Production Association.
  • Types and Functions:
    • Mobile Version: Installed on vehicles and armored vehicles, it can form an interference dome within a range of 50 to 200 meters, suppressing the standard frequencies and most non-standard frequencies for drone control.
    • Portable Version: Designed as a backpack style, it is used to protect personnel from attacks by “First Person View” (FPV) drones and drones carrying thrown ammunition, powered by built-in batteries, with shockproof and weatherproof casings, and can be carried in a backpack.
Other Electronic Warfare Tools and Systems
  • “Flounder” Portable System: Developed by SKY-X, it has proven effective in the special military operation zone, enabling drones to “force land or return to the starting point”, with a compact design that can fit into a tactical backpack.
  • “Sphere” Drone Detection and Suppression System: On January 17, 2025, according to a report by vpk, the system has been successfully tested in large urban activities and has proven its effectiveness in free zones. Based on the Sphere system, it can cover an area of several square kilometers, and equipment installed on vehicles has shot down more than 10 enemy combat drones on the line of contact. The system can determine the control channels and video signals of drones, and then automatically or manually initiate electronic warfare, and can also configure the defense system according to specific targets and purposes.
  • Airspace Control System (ACS): A unique system that has begun operation in the Moscow area, not only can it detect airplanes or helicopters, but it can also detect extremely low-altitude micro drones and target air defense or electronic warfare systems. Its airborne radar is a network of radar stations with fixed phased array antennas, which can be installed in a variety of locations, and can detect “Baba Yaga” type drones as well as aircraft-type drones that attack industrial facilities, etc. Cessna-type aircraft can be detected within a distance of 30 kilometers, and long-range Boeing aircraft can be detected at a distance of more than 90 kilometers. The system can track up to 20 aircraft at the same time, including small drones, and determine their types, altitudes, and distances.

Advantages and Limitations of Electronic Warfare Tools
  • Advantages: The use of electronic warfare systems helps reduce the possibility of special forces being attacked by drones, can also disrupt the communication of the defending enemy, and protecting cities and infrastructure is safer than air defense missile systems. It is the safest to use in large-scale activities.
  • Limitations: For example, anti-drone guns do not always interfere with drones using non-standard control frequencies. Electronic warfare backpacks are not suitable for use while on the move, as ultra-high-frequency electromagnetic radiation can cause certain harm to the human body. Even if a drone is destroyed, its fragments may fall and cause damage.
Current Situation of Research and Development and Application
  • Civil Military-Industrial Complex and Defense Industry: The focus of work is to provide the latest anti-drone tools for the army, and electronic warfare systems have played a key role.
  • Infantry Electronic Warfare Tools: The most common are portable systems, such as anti-drone guns and tactical backpacks. Russia's currently produced portable electronic warfare tools can suppress signals of 6 to 8 frequencies.
  • Expert Opinions: Military experts believe that Russia has done a good job in the research and development of electronic warfare systems. Now, dozens of different complexes created by small teams are effectively protecting equipment in their areas. However, state-owned enterprises have more opportunities in terms of funds, experts, and equipment, and can quickly launch new development projects, while small companies find it more difficult in this regard.
